Adlington (Cheshire) train station is equipped with ticket machines that allow passengers to collect pre-purchased tickets and buy tickets on the spot. The station is accessible, providing step-free access to some areas, and there is an induction loop for those with hearing impairments. While there is CCTV in place, ensuring a level of security for travelers, the station does lack some facilities such as toilets, waiting rooms, and refreshment options. Travelers are advised to bring any necessary refreshments with them before arriving at the station.
For those planning to use their smartcards, they can be issued at the station, although there are no validators available. Passengers with disabilities can expect assistance through Passenger Assist, enabling them to travel with confidence.
Though Adlington (Cheshire) is a smaller station, it accommodates easy connections to various modes of transport. Rail replacement buses operate from bus stops located on London Road, providing alternative options during rail disruptions. For those needing a taxi, the Cab4You service offers convenient travel arrangements. Additionally, details about onward bus connections, including timetables, can be accessed in printed formats or online.

Bearsted Train Station is equipped to meet a variety of traveler needs, offering a good range of facilities for maximum convenience. If you need to purchase tickets, the station's ticket office is open Monday to Friday from 06:10 to 19:30, Saturday from 07:10 to 13:50, and Sunday from 07:40 to 15:10. For those with online tickets, collection is hassle-free at the ticket machine, which is conveniently accessible on Platform 1 for those with mobility impairments.
Travelers can find amenities such as toilets in the booking hall, available during staffing hours, with fully accessible toilets for travelers requiring step-free access. Meanwhile, refreshments are available at a coffee kiosk on site, although you'll need to plan ahead for other shopping needs as there are no shops or ATMs at the station.
The station earns a Category A rating for accessibility. This means it provides step-free access throughout, including lifts and ramps to assist anyone with mobility restrictions. While there aren’t wheelchair services directly available or dedicated accessible taxis, there are three accessible parking spaces on the premises operated by APCOA Parking. Be sure to contact Southeastern Customer Services for any specific assistance before your travel.
Once you arrive at Bearsted, there's more than one way to continue your journey. The station serves as a hub with bus services connecting travelers to key areas like Ashford, with a bus stop located just outside the station car park, referenced under the What3Words location "panel.cheat.tins". For those heading towards Maidstone, the bus stop is conveniently located across the street, accessible under "become.lifted.almost". Unfortunately, no local cycle hire services are available, so consider buses or car hire for your onward adventures.
